sqlserver时间查询(sqlserver 数据库查询一个时间段根据年月日三个字段,注意是三个字段)
本文目录
sqlserver 数据库查询一个时间段根据年月日三个字段,注意是三个字段
我刚写了一个MySQL的类似sql查询。
1、将年、月、日和小时组合成一个字符串
2、月日时如果不是两位,在前面补0
3、将字符和判断区间的字符串值进行比较
select * from 表 where CONCAT(vyear,LPAD(vmonth,2,0),LPAD(vday,2,0),LPAD(Hour,2,0)) 》= ’2017081000’ and CONCAT(vyear,LPAD(vmonth,2,0),LPAD(vday,2,0),LPAD(Hour,2,0)) 《= ’2017081023’
sqlserver的datetime查询
sql的datetime查询使用convert函数格式化输出格式convert函数语法:CONVERT(data_type(length),data_to_be_converted,style)data_type(length) 规定目标数据类型(带有可选的长度)。data_to_be_converted 含有需要转换的值。style 规定日期/时间的输出格式。可以使用的 style 值如图:例:
SQLSERVER特定时间段查询
DECLARE @dt DATETIMEDECLARE @dt2 DATETIMESET @dt = ’2008-07-24’SET @dt2 = DATEADD(day, 1, @dt)select @dt as dt, @dt2 as dt2select * from meet_now where meetdate between CONVERT(datetime , @dt, 111 ) and convert(datetime , @dt2, 111 ) order by idselect * from meet_now where DATEDIFF(day, meetdate, @dt) = 0 order by id
SQLSERVER用日期做条件查询详情请进!
你的Time字段是时间类型,当然不能用Like去和字符串进行匹配这样就可以:select * from message where Datediff(d,createTime,’2009-10-10’) = 0
更多文章:
VR虚拟现实与VM虚拟制造有什么区别?VM虚拟机怎么新建虚拟机
2024年6月10日 19:55
maintain短语(英语maintain its effectiveness怎么翻译)
2024年6月21日 12:54
电脑显示shell什么意思(计算机上的“shell”是什么)
2024年10月18日 23:10
canvas保存psd(为什么我的openCanvas无法保存文件)
2024年5月16日 16:31
decode函数用法python(为什么python decode每效果)
2023年10月30日 10:00
accessory怎么记(auxiliary和accessery 的区别)
2024年7月19日 04:46
phonegap和eclipse(eclipse怎么配置phonegap完成nfc插件)
2024年5月16日 20:21
【计算机系统】进程和线程(process and thread)?进程 [jìn chéng]什么意思近义词和反义词是什么英文翻译是什么
2024年7月13日 05:10
特斯拉刹车失灵有几例(女子喇叭喊话特斯拉刹车失灵致追尾,特斯拉车辆都出过哪些事故)
2024年6月22日 02:52
脚本多线程是什么意思(Unity3d中的脚本是多线程还是单线程)
2024年7月5日 09:24
zookeeper官网(【ZooKeeper】ZooKeeper 3.4.14安装配置及简单使用)
2024年7月24日 01:10